网奇CMS - 成熟易用的.NET网站管理系统
旧版官网 | 客服论坛 | 彩虹服务 | 加入收藏 | TEL:400-600-2788

自主开发.net CMS系统革命历程

  1 Cms的革命

  CMS项目的进行中,最多的是压力。

  时间的压力,上线的压力,使用者给予的压力,继续完善的压力。

  这些压力所带来的记忆和错觉让我经常想来回顾这场革命。

  1.1 Cms的年轮

  2007年1月初步策划

  2007年3月中旬开始代码编写

  2007年6月12日主体代码结束

  2007年7月底全部站点使用上cms

  2007年9月18日初步功能完善与新增结束

  1.2 Cms革命成果

  1、节省网站服务器与数据库服务器资源50%,包括内存,cpu。

  2、增加了服务器的稳定性和安全性。

  3、建立了负载均衡的基础条件,页面多版本机制,流量负载的程序基础。

  4、建立了可支持几乎任何类型网站系统基础;保证了我们可以快速的建立,修改站点,把所有不可能变成了可能。

  1.3 革命的压力

  1.3.1 时间的压力

  Cms经历了一个完整的产品流程,包括了前期的架构规划,需求分析,中期的代码编写,后期的上线,以及持续的人性化修改和新功能补充。

  在cms进行的十个月中,也是我进入公司的十个月中,时间不全是花在了cms上,有很多其他的事情在占用时间。记得最长一次,我停了半个月的开发。

  代码编写时间是三个月。三个月中真正用于cms的时间大概是两个月。

  两个人用半年多时间将如此庞大优秀的站点,进行了如此大个革命,并且是在不耽误其他很多事情的情况下,对于时间上的怀疑,我只能说问心无愧,

  1.3.2 上线的压力和使用者给予的压力

  一个新事物的诞生是伟大的,推广和使用它是困难的。

  Cms的上线不单是一个替代,更像是革新,带来风险和新习惯。

  风险让人举步不前,不适应让人慌乱。对于这种压力我只能说,团队需要的是互相理解,互相支持。

  为了一个目标承受风险、压力和改变习惯是可以也是必须接受的。

  1.3.3 继续完善的压力

  为什么要继续完善,因为我们会有新的产品,还要兼容旧的产品(大肚皮、听游戏、等站)。

  当然这个继续是阶段性的,会有新的名称和时间表,但还是让人感到这个项目没完没了,不过原因是站点没完没了的发展造成了cms的出现和继续完善。

  这个压力无可避免落在相关人员身上,我们只能说让完善来的更猛烈些吧。

  1.4 结束语

  Cms上线对原有的网站频道与栏目做了调整和整合,自己也从一个单纯的开发者变成一个使用者、规划者,丰富了产品了解。

  Cms这条主线贯穿了07年的9个月,对我们U9来说也许是渺小的,但对于程序组意义重大,相信每个组员都这么认为。我们付出了汗水,睡眠,口水,眼药水,换来了在看到主服务器内存占用从原来的2.5G变成600M的欣喜和自豪,换来了对任何网站改动说可以的满足感,换来了为采编节省工作步骤时让他们请吃饭的快乐。

  即将开始新的工程,给自己些回顾。我们程序部一定高喊“不怕遗忘,就怕否认”的口号勇往直前的接受挑战。

0 顶一下 打印 阅读:
建站知识中最有帮助的文章